Job description
Overview

You will work closely with the Talent Acquisition Manager, Talent Acquisition Assistant Manager and hiring Partners across the country. You will have a particular responsibility for researching markets and sourcing candidates into a number of specified areas of the business. Your main focus will be to increase the number and percentage of quality direct hires into RSM, whilst also providing essential support across a variety of processes across the recruitment function.

Responsibilities
  • Pro-actively source direct candidates and build long term relationships with talent that is both ready now and for the future. Identifying as many direct candidates as possible to contribute to the reduction of RSM's usage of recruitment agencies
  • Manage the end-to-end recruitment process for your own portfolio of vacancies (briefing, screening candidates, advertising on relevant channels, creating Talent Maps and insights, through to offer and onboarding)
  • Keep candidate applications updated and moved efficiently through the recruitment process with the use of our ATS (Phenom)
  • Attend recruitment scoping meetings with hiring Partners to understand the brief of each role before starting to source candidates and keep them fully updated on progress
  • Support the Talent Acquisition Assistant Manager in delivering on recruitment projects
  • Deliver a high standard of client service and be an ambassador of RSM
  • Recruit the right person for the right job within the agreed timeframe; communicate with all parties; help the recruitment team improve client service and drive down recruitment costs
  • Demonstrate a solid understanding of the recruitment project lifecycle
  • Be confident in using LinkedIn Recruiter and other talent sourcing tools
  • Ability to manage diverse and sometimes complex roles with specific requirements (e.g., professional qualifications)
  • Demonstrate excellent client service and relationship-building skills
  • Show strong organisational and prioritisation skills
Requirements / Qualifications
  • Experience in a resourcing capacity, either within an agency or in-house context, and a passion for in-house recruitment across specialist sectors
